German Bundestag passes second act on the adaptation of data protection law to the GDPR
New law passed on the adaptation of German data protection law to the GDPR - Following the amendment of the Federal Data Protection Act ("BDSG") in 2017, on 27 June 2019 the German Bundestag passed a second act to adapt the highly fragmented German...
